[{"type":"text","content":"-- At All Doses Evaluated, VAX-24 Was Well-Tolerated and Demonstrated a Safety and Tolerability Profile Similar to Prevnar 20® (PCV20) -- -- At All Doses Evaluated, VAX-24 Elicited Substantial Immune Responses Following Primary Three-Dose Immunization Series; Topline Results Also Include Interim Booster Dose IgG Data Showing Robust Memory Responses Across All Doses -- -- Dose-Dependent Immune Responses Consistently Demonstrated and Little to No Evidence of Carrier Suppression Was Observed, Supporting Platform’s Potential to Deliver Broadest-Spectrum Infant Pneumococcal Conjugate Vaccine (PCV) Candidates -- -- Company Selects VAX-24 Mid Dose (2.2mcg) as Basis for Optimized Dose Formulation for Advancement to Potential Infant Phase 3 Program, Pending Topline VAX-31 Infant Phase 2 Study Readout -- -- Company Announces VAX-XL, Third-Generation PCV Candidate Designed to Further Expand Spectrum of Coverage -- -- Company to Host Webcast/Conference Call Today at 8:00 a.m. ET / 5:00 a.m. PT -- SAN CARLOS, Calif., March 31,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Vaxcyte, Inc. (Nasdaq: PCVX), a clinical-stage vaccine innovation company engineering high-fidelity vaccines to protect humankind from the consequences of bacterial diseases, today shared positive topline results from its Phase 2 dose-finding study evaluating the safety, tolerability and immunogenicity of VAX-24, the Company’s 24-valent pneumococcal conjugate vaccine (PCV) candidate designed to prevent invasive pneumococcal disease (IPD), compared to Prevnar 20® (PCV20) in healthy infants. Based on these findings, the Company has selected the VAX-24 Mid dose as the basis for advancement of an optimized dose formulation to a potential Phase 3 program and, pending the VAX-31 infant Phase 2 study topline data results anticipated in mid-2026, plans to initiate an infant Phase 3 study with either VAX-24 or VAX-31. In this study, VAX-24 was well-tolerated and demonstrated a safety profile similar to PCV20 across all doses studied. Frequently reported local and systemic reactions were generally mild-to-moderate, resolving within several days of vaccination, with no meaningful differences observed across the cohorts.
